Oblivion Sales Top 3 Million, Expansion Pack Planned
 
Bethesda Softworks has announced that it will be releasing the official expansion of its bestselling game The Elder Scrolls IV: Oblivion later this year, even as the games sales cleared the 3 million mark.

Sunday, January 21, 2007 The first official expansion pack for the award-winning role playing game, The Elder Scrolls IV: Oblivion will be released in Spring this year, according to developers, Bethesda Softworks. The announcement came even as the game’s sales soared past the 3 million mark. Titled The Elder Scrolls IV: Shivering Isles, the expansion pack will be released for both Windows and the Xbox 360.




The pack features more than 30 hours of new gameplay, and will allow gamers to explore an entirely new plane of Oblivion – the realm of Sheogorath, the Daedric Prince of Madness. Shivering Isles will be added to the existing world of Oblivion, so players can continue playing with their existing save game/characters, or create an all new character just to explore the new content. Within the Realm of Sheogorath, players will be able to explore the two extreme sides of the god’s madness – the sublimely creative and the completely psychotic. The expansion pack features a bizarre landscape split between the two sides – Mania and Dementia –filled with vast, twisting dungeons mirroring the roots of the trees they are buried within. Players will encounter encounter more than a dozen new creatures including hideous insects, Flesh Atronachs, skeletal Shambles, amphibious Grummites; as well as discover all new items, ingredients, spells, and more.

“We’re thrilled with the response that Oblivion has received to date and feel that Shivering Isles will offer a whole new and different experience to anyone who played and enjoyed Oblivion,” said Todd Howard, executive producer for The Elder Scrolls.

“The enthusiastic response we’ve received to our downloadable content has been overwhelming, and we’re excited to bring Oblivion fans a full expansion,” said Vlatko Andonov, president of Bethesda Softworks. “The world we’ve created for Shivering Isles is unlike anything you’ve seen or played in Oblivion and we can’t wait for folks to play it.”
